Also preferring deep-soiled bottomlands, black walnut (Juglans nigra) grows in central Kansas and is hardy in USDA zones 4 through 9. Black walnut produces toxins in the area directly beneath the tree which can affect growth of other plants nearby, and husks can stain pavement and sidewalks. Growing widely throughout the state in almost any soil type, dandelion (Taraxacum officinale) yields tender, young, spring leaves for salads and cooking greens. Growing 75 to 100 feet tall and 40 to 70 feet wide, trees prefer river bottoms.
